Dental Procedures
- Fissure sealants are used to seal pits and fissures on teeth, and are made of thin resin material.
- Flap surgery is a dental procedure that involves lifting gum tissue to expose and clean underlying tooth and bone structures.
- Freeway space refers to the distance between the upper and lower teeth when the lower teeth are in a resting position.
